I dunno, maybe there's something wrong with me, but I really enjoyed this. Say what you want about old mate W. S., but he directs brainless guilty pleasure action movies with a style and energy that few can match, and the gulf in quality between this and the previous two installments helmed by different directors is a testament to that. Sure this film is derivative (why not just call the antagonist 'Agent Smith With Tentacles' and be done with it?), and very, very stupid, but I fail to see why that should stop anyone from enjoying it. My only problems were the underwhelming finale and the fact that Wentworth Miller didn't have the prison escape plan tattooed on his chest, but judged for what it is I think this is definitely a good movie, and possibly even a great one.

After four Resident Evil movies, I suddenly GET IT. These are the Millennium's equivalent of the Saturday matinée serial. The structure is simple: We go from threat to solution to threat to solution, over and over, up to and including the cliffhanger endings of each film, never stopping for long to get to know the characters. Somebody could chop up the entire saga, put a bit of vintage production on top, and show it in installments. For example, Extinction had ended on a crazy cliffhanger, and resolves it in Afterlife's first sequence, then we're off on the next adventure. Threat-resolve, threat-resolve, until the end (and we end on threat, resolve to come in Part 5). So in this one, Alice and Claire join a group of survivors trapped in a Los Angeles prison, including pre-Captain Cold Wentworth Miller (type-cast as a dude trapped in a prison), get involved in ridiculous stunt and fight gags that had me laughing out loud (it's a win), and trying to find the Promised Land free of infection. Embracing its place as B-movie trash, it apes The Matrix more than 10 years on, with the villain channeling Agent Smith, and bullet time effects. Why not? Set brain to crazy mode and enjoy.
